Why California Farms Need High-Voltage Energy Storage

California's agricultural sector drinks electricity like thirsty crops need water. With 80% of the state's developed water supply used for irrigation, farmers face a double whammy – dwindling water resources and skyrocketing energy costs. Enter GoodWe ESS high-voltage storage systems – the Swiss Army knife for modern farming energy needs.

The Solar-Storage Irrigation Revolution

Imagine almond orchards where solar panels double as shade structures for crops while charging 2,000V battery banks. A Central Valley pilot project showed:

  • 40% reduction in grid dependence during peak irrigation
  • 72-hour backup power for drip irrigation systems
  • 15% increase in pump efficiency through voltage stabilization

Technical Sweet Spot: 1500V Architecture

GoodWe's high-voltage systems aren't just about brute force – they're precision instruments. The 1500V DC architecture reduces energy loss by 30% compared to traditional 1000V systems. For perspective: That's enough saved power to run 50 center-pivot irrigators simultaneously across 500 acres.

Water-Energy Nexus Optimization

Farmers joke that in California, "every drop of water has an electron attached." Smart storage solutions now enable:

  • Time-shifting solar energy for nighttime irrigation
  • Instant response to grid demand response programs
  • Seamless integration with variable frequency drives (VFDs)

Future-Proofing Farm Operations

The latest DC-coupled storage configurations are changing the game. One Salinas Valley vegetable grower reported:

  • 92% round-trip efficiency for solar self-consumption
  • 4.7-year payback period through CAISO energy arbitrage
  • 25% smaller balance-of-system costs

Beyond Kilowatt-Hours: The Ancillary Benefits

High-voltage storage isn't just about energy – it's becoming a farm management platform. Modern systems now integrate:

  • Soil moisture monitoring via power quality sensors
  • Predictive maintenance for irrigation pumps
  • Carbon credit tracking through energy analytics
